What is a remote genetic counselor?

A Remote Genetic Counselor provides genetic counseling services virtually, helping patients understand their genetic risks for various health conditions. They assess family and medical histories, explain genetic testing options, and support patients in making informed decisions. These professionals work from home or a remote location, using telehealth platforms for consultations. Remote genetic counselors may be employed by hospitals, telehealth companies, or research institutions. This role allows for flexibility while maintaining patient-centered care.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ote genetic counselor?

To thrive as a Remote Genetic Counselor, you need a master's degree in genetic counseling, board certification, and expertise in medical genetics and genomics. You should be proficient with telehealth platforms, secure electronic medical records systems, and genetic testing databases. Exceptional interpersonal skills, clear virtual communication, and cultural sensitivity are vital for providing patient-centered care from a distance. These competencies ensure accurate assessment, effective patient support, and high-quality service delivery in a virtual care environment.

What are some common challenges faced by remote genetic counselors, and how are they typically addressed?

Remote Genetic Counselors often face challenges such as building rapport with patients through virtual platforms, ensuring privacy and compliance with health regulations, and effectively coordinating care with healthcare providers remotely. To address these, counselors utilize secure telehealth systems, adhere to strict confidentiality protocols, and participate in ongoing training for virtual communication techniques. Regular team meetings and digital collaboration tools help maintain strong connections with colleagues and manage complex cases efficiently. Employers also provide access to robust IT support and continuing education to ensure effective remote practice.

Can I become a remote genetic counselor online?

Yes, many genetic counseling programs now offer online or hybrid formats, allowing individuals to complete coursework and some clinical training remotely. However, certification through the American Board of Genetic Counseling (ABGC) typically requires in-person supervised clinical experience, which may limit fully remote practice until certification is achieved.

Is there a shortage of remote genetic counselors?

The demand for remote genetic counselors has increased due to the growth of telehealth services and expanding genetic testing. While job opportunities are generally strong, regional shortages can vary depending on healthcare infrastructure and access to specialized training or certification. Overall, the field is experiencing a positive employment outlook with ongoing need for qualified professionals.
